Baked Cinnamon Sugar Apple Chips

Ingredients
  

3 medium-sized apples (such as Fuji or Honeycrisp)

2 tablespoons granulated sugar

1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ional)

A pinch of salt

Cooking spray or parchment paper for baking sheets

Instructions
 

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 225°F (110°C). This low temperature will help dehydrate the apples slowly.

    Prepare the Apples: Wash and dry the apples thoroughly. Using a mandoline slicer or a sharp knife, slice the apples very thinly, about 1/8 inch thick. Remove any seeds if they remain in the slices.

      Mix Cinnamon Sugar: In a small bowl, combine the granulated sugar, ground cinnamon, and a pinch of salt. If using, add the vanilla extract for an extra layer of flavor.

        Coat the Apple Slices: Arrange the apple slices in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Lightly spray the slices with cooking spray or brush them with a very light coating of oil to help the cinnamon sugar adhere. Sprinkle the cinnamon-sugar mixture evenly over the apple slices.

          Bake the Chips: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for about 1.5 to 2 hours. Flip the apple slices halfway through to ensure even baking. The chips are ready when they are dry and crisp but still slightly bend without breaking.

            Cool and Store: Once done, remove the apple chips from the oven and let them cool completely. They will become crunchier as they cool. Store in an airtight container to maintain crispness.

              Serve and Enjoy: Enjoy your homemade baked cinnamon sugar apple chips as a healthy snack or a delightful addition to salads and desserts!

                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 10 minutes | 2 hours 15 minutes | 4 servings
